Six Lake Victoria counties to receive Ksh. 7.4B  for ecological restoration

Six counties in the Lake Victoria region will receive 7.4 billion shillings by the end of the week to facilitate the restoration of ecological zones destroyed by climate change. 

Speaking in Kisumu on Monday, Treasury CS Prof. Njuguna Ndung’u indicated that the funds are part of a $297 million grant issued under the FLOCCA programme to support locally led climate resilient projects.

 The CS further reiterated on the need to invest in mitigation of the effects of climate change in order to cushion the country's economy which heavily relies on natural resources. 

On her part, Environment CS Sopian Tuya commended the commitment by the council of governors to set aside 1.5% of their annual development budgets to mitigate the effects of climate change.

"I am seeking appointments from you excellency governors for us to agree on an eco system even agree to model tree nurseries with fruit trees and fodder trees that will go a long way in addressing the food security needs and the livelihood needs of the communities we are talking about so that we stage the stage with FLOCCA and when the KEWASI funds come we build on that and scale up."Soipan Tuya, CS, Environment, Climate Change and Forestry said. 

Elsewhere, Prof. Njuguna Ndung’u,  the  Cabinet Secretary, National Treasury and Economic Planning, state said the engagement underscores the unwavering commitment of the government of Kenya to combat the effects of climate change. 

"Today’s engagement underscores the unwavering commitment of the government of Kenya to combat the effects of climate change and reverse these damaging effects of climate change through the implementation of an enabling policy in partnership with the government of Germany we are intensifying financial support at the local level." he said.
